Role Overview
We are seeking an experienced Engineering Program Manager based in Singapore to lead complex custom silicon development programs end‑to‑end. This high‑impact role drives program execution across global cross‑functional teams, partnering closely with engineering leaders and cloud datacenter customers

You will:

  • Own full lifecycle execution for custom silicon programs—from planning and development to validation, ramp, and production release

  • Drive cross‑functional teams (design, DFT, PD, package, test, ops) to meet schedule, quality, and cost

  • Lead APAC‑timezone engagement: daily CFT cadence, customer alignment, risk reviews, and change control

  • Build strong relationships with customer engineering and internal executives

  • Identify risks early, drive mitigations, and maintain governance using MPLC/PSM processes

  • Influence decisions across geographies and mentor junior PMs

Interview Integrity 

To support fair and authentic hiring practices, candidates are not permitted to use AI tools (such as transcription apps, real-time answer generators like ChatGPT or Copilot, or automated note-taking bots) during interviews.

These tools must not be used to record, assist with, or enhance responses in any way. Our interviews are designed to evaluate your individual experience, thought process, and communication skills in real time. Use of AI tools without prior instruction from the interviewer will result in disqualification from the hiring process.

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
